金融行业的数据处理需求一直以来都是高效、准确和实时的。面对海量的数据流动,如何在不影响业务的情况下实现数据的高效同步,成为金融机构的关键挑战。特别是在金融行业,数据的准确性是不可妥协的,因为任何数据的偏差都可能导致严重的财务后果。因此,了解并应用有效的数据同步方法至关重要。

在金融行业中,定时多表同步是一种常见的数据管理策略。它不仅可以提高数据处理的效率,还能确保数据的一致性和准确性。本文将深入探讨定时多表同步在金融行业的应用,帮助您理解其重要性和实施策略。
🏦 一、定时多表同步的基本概念
1. 定时多表同步的工作原理
在金融行业,定时多表同步是指在预设的时间间隔内,将多个数据库表中的数据进行一致性同步的过程。这种方法的核心在于高效处理大量数据,同时保持数据的一致性和准确性。定时多表同步通常涉及以下几个步骤:
- 数据源识别:确定需要同步的原始数据表。
- 数据变更捕获:检测数据的变化,包括插入、更新和删除操作。
- 数据传输与转换:将捕获的数据变更传输到目标数据库,并进行必要的数据格式转换。
- 数据合并与更新:将转换后的数据合并到目标数据库中,确保数据的最新状态和一致性。
步骤 | 描述 | 重要性 |
---|---|---|
数据源识别 | 确定需要同步的表和字段 | 确保同步的范围和数据准确性 |
数据变更捕获 | 捕获数据的插入、更新和删除操作 | 维持数据的实时性和完整性 |
数据传输与转换 | 传输并转换数据以适应目标数据库 | 确保数据格式的一致性 |
数据合并与更新 | 将转换后的数据合并到目标数据库 | 保证数据的最新状态和一致性 |
通过以上步骤,定时多表同步可以实现高效的数据管理,尤其是在金融行业需要频繁更新和访问的场景中。
2. 应用场景与挑战
在金融行业,定时多表同步被广泛应用于以下几个场景:
- 跨国银行的分支数据整合:通过定时多表同步,将分布在各地的分支银行数据实时同步到总部系统,以便进行统一管理和决策。
- 实时风控系统:金融机构需要实时监控各类交易风险,确保数据的最新性对于风险控制系统至关重要。
- 客户信息更新:定期同步客户数据,确保CRM系统中的数据是最新的,支持个性化的客户服务。
尽管定时多表同步具有显著的优势,但在实施过程中也面临着一些挑战:
- 数据一致性问题:如何确保在同步过程中数据的一致性,避免因网络延迟或系统故障导致的数据不一致。
- 性能瓶颈:同步大规模数据时,如何保证系统的性能不受影响。
- 安全性:金融数据的同步过程需要确保数据的安全和隐私不被泄露。
通过了解这些概念和挑战,金融行业的从业者可以更好地设计和优化数据同步策略,以满足业务需求。
📊 二、保障数据准确性的策略
1. 数据完整性检查
在金融行业,数据的准确性直接影响业务决策和客户信任。因此,在定时多表同步过程中,数据完整性检查是必不可少的一环。完整性检查的核心在于确保数据在源端和目标端的一致性,防止数据丢失或篡改。
实施数据完整性检查的策略包括:
- 事务管理:利用数据库事务来确保数据操作的原子性、一致性、隔离性和持久性(ACID特性)。
- 数据校验机制:在数据传输前后进行校验,以验证数据是否被篡改或丢失。
- 审计日志:记录数据同步过程中的所有操作,以便在出现问题时进行追溯和分析。
策略 | 描述 | 重要性 |
---|---|---|
事务管理 | 确保数据操作的原子性和一致性 | 防止数据不一致和丢失 |
数据校验机制 | 验证数据的完整性和准确性 | 确保数据在传输过程中的可靠性 |
审计日志 | 记录所有数据操作,便于追溯分析 | 提供问题解决的依据和历史记录 |
通过这些策略,可以有效提高金融机构的数据同步准确性,减少因数据错误导致的业务风险。

2. 高效的数据同步工具
选择合适的数据同步工具对金融行业数据的准确性保障同样重要。FineDataLink(简称FDL)作为一款国产的、高效实用的低代码ETL工具,在金融行业的数据同步中表现出色。FDL支持实时和离线的数据采集、集成、管理,帮助金融机构实现多表同步的高效性和准确性。
- 低代码实现:用户无需编写复杂代码即可配置和管理数据同步任务,降低了技术门槛。
- 实时数据传输:支持对数据源进行单表、多表、整库、多对一的实时全量和增量同步,确保数据实时更新。
- 数据调度与治理:提供强大的数据调度与治理功能,确保数据在传输过程中的安全和一致性。
在金融行业,选择FDL这样的工具,不仅可以提高数据同步的效率,还能确保数据的准确性和安全性: FineDataLink体验Demo 。
🔍 三、成功案例与实践经验
1. 案例分析:某大型银行的数据同步策略
某大型银行在全球拥有数百个分支机构,其数据同步策略的成功实施为许多金融机构提供了有益的借鉴。这家银行采用定时多表同步的方式,将各地分支的数据实时同步到总部系统,以实现全球统一管理。
其策略的成功要素包括:
- 分布式架构:采用分布式系统架构,确保数据同步的灵活性和可扩展性。
- 智能调度系统:利用智能调度系统,根据数据量和网络状况动态调整同步频率,提高数据传输效率。
- 多层次安全机制:实施多层次的安全机制,确保数据在传输过程中的机密性和完整性。
成功要素 | 描述 | 成功原因 |
---|---|---|
分布式架构 | 提供灵活性和可扩展性 | 适应全球分支机构的复杂环境 |
智能调度系统 | 动态调整同步频率,提高传输效率 | 优化资源利用,减少延迟 |
多层次安全机制 | 确保数据机密性和完整性 | 防止数据泄露和篡改 |
通过这些措施,该银行实现了高效、准确的数据同步,显著提高了业务决策的及时性和准确性。
2. 实践经验:提升数据同步效率的技巧
在实际操作中,提升数据同步效率的技巧包括:
- 优化网络环境:改善网络带宽和稳定性,可以显著提高数据同步的速度。
- 使用增量同步:在可能的情况下,优先使用增量同步而非全量同步,以减少数据传输量。
- 定期监控与优化:定期监控同步过程中的性能指标,并根据监控结果进行优化调整。
这些实践经验可以有效提高金融行业的数据同步效率,为机构的高效运营提供支持。
📘 引用与参考
- 《大数据时代的金融科技》, 王晓霖, 2020
- 《数据库系统概念》, Abraham Silberschatz, 2019
- 《数据集成与管理》, 李佳, 2021
📈 四、总结与展望
定时多表同步在金融行业中的应用,不仅提高了数据处理的效率,还在很大程度上保障了数据的准确性。通过深入理解其基本概念、实施策略和成功案例,金融机构可以更好地设计和优化数据同步方案,以应对日益复杂的数据管理挑战。FineDataLink作为一个高效的低代码ETL工具,为金融行业的数字化转型提供了强有力的支持。未来,随着技术的不断进步,数据同步策略将更为智能化和自动化,为金融行业带来更多的创新机会。
通过本文的探讨,我们希望能够帮助金融机构更好地理解和应用定时多表同步技术,提升数据管理的整体水平。
本文相关FAQs
🚀 数据同步在金融行业的挑战是什么?
在金融行业,数据的准确性和实时性至关重要,尤其是面对大量的交易和用户数据时。老板要求实现高性能的增量同步,但现有的批量定时同步机制似乎效率不佳,而且风险高,如何解决这个问题?有没有大佬能分享一下成功案例或实用策略?
金融行业的数据同步面临着独特的挑战。首先,金融机构的数据种类繁多,涉及交易记录、客户信息、风险评估等多个维度,这就要求数据同步机制能够处理复杂的数据结构和庞大的数据量。同时,金融行业的数据敏感性极高,任何数据的错误或延迟都可能导致严重的后果。因此,确保数据的实时性和准确性是金融机构的首要任务。
传统的批量定时同步方式通常会遇到以下几个问题:
- 性能瓶颈:当数据量巨大时,批量同步可能导致系统负载过高,影响其他业务的正常运行。
- 数据准确性:由于同步周期的限制,数据可能存在一定的延迟,无法满足实时数据分析的需求。
- 操作复杂性:需要频繁调整和优化同步策略,以应对不断变化的业务需求和数据环境。
为解决这些问题,金融机构可以考虑以下策略:
- 实时增量同步:通过实时数据流技术,可以实现数据的实时更新和同步,确保数据的及时性和准确性。
- 数据分片和并行处理:针对大数据量的同步需求,可以采用数据分片和并行处理的方法,提高数据同步的效率。
- 使用专业数据集成平台:例如FineDataLink(FDL)这样的低代码数据集成平台,可以帮助金融机构简化数据同步流程,提高数据管理的效率和准确性。FDL支持实时全量和增量同步,并具备强大的数据适配能力,能够灵活应对复杂的数据结构和同步需求。
通过这些策略,金融机构可以有效提升数据同步的效率和准确性,为业务决策提供可靠的数据支持。 FineDataLink体验Demo 。
📊 如何设计高效的数据同步方案以保障金融数据的准确性?
有没有人和我一样在头疼金融数据同步的设计?老板要求我们设计一个既高效又准确的数据同步方案,在面对复杂的金融数据时,应该如何规划和实施?
设计高效的数据同步方案是保障金融数据准确性的关键步骤之一。在金融行业,数据的复杂性和敏感性要求同步方案能够灵活适应多变的业务需求,同时保持高效和准确。以下是一些设计高效数据同步方案的建议:

- 明确业务需求和数据特征:首先,需要深入了解金融业务的具体需求,以及数据的特征和结构。这包括数据的类型、来源、更新频率等信息,以便设计适合的同步策略。
- 选择合适的同步技术:根据数据的特征和业务需求,选择合适的同步技术。例如,对于实时性要求较高的数据,可以采用实时流数据同步技术;对于数据量较大的场景,可以考虑批量同步结合增量更新的方法。
- 分布式数据库和微服务架构:利用分布式数据库和微服务架构,可以提高数据同步的效率和可靠性。分布式数据库能够处理大规模的数据,微服务架构则可以灵活地进行数据处理和传输。
- 数据治理和质量监控:实施有效的数据治理和质量监控机制,确保同步过程中数据的准确性和完整性。这包括数据的校验、错误处理和恢复机制等。
- 自动化和智能化工具:使用自动化和智能化的数据集成工具,如FineDataLink(FDL),可以简化数据同步的流程,提高数据处理的效率和准确性。FDL提供丰富的数据适配和处理能力,能够轻松应对金融行业复杂的数据同步需求。
通过这些设计策略,金融机构可以构建高效的数据同步方案,确保数据的准确性和实时性,为业务发展提供坚实的数据支持。
🛠️ 实现金融行业数据同步的实际案例有哪些?
有没有大佬能分享一下金融行业实现数据同步的实际案例?我想了解一下别人都是怎么做的,有哪些经验可以借鉴?
在金融行业,成功实现数据同步的案例不胜枚举,以下是几个具有代表性的实际案例,供大家参考和借鉴:
- 某银行的实时交易数据同步:
- 背景:某大型银行需要实时同步海量的交易数据,以支持实时风险分析和决策。
- 解决方案:采用FineDataLink(FDL)平台,通过实时流数据同步技术,将每笔交易数据实时传输到中央数据仓库,以便进行实时分析和监控。
- 成效:实现了数据的实时更新和同步,极大提高了风险分析的效率和准确性,为银行的决策提供了可靠的数据支持。
- 金融科技公司的用户行为数据同步:
- 背景:一家金融科技公司需要同步用户行为数据,以支持个性化推荐和营销活动。
- 解决方案:利用FDL平台的灵活数据适配功能,将用户行为数据从多个渠道进行整合和同步,构建统一的用户画像。
- 成效:提高了用户行为数据的同步效率和准确性,增强了个性化推荐的效果,提升了用户的满意度和转化率。
- 保险公司的客户信息数据同步:
- 背景:某保险公司需要同步客户信息数据,以支持精准营销和客户关系管理。
- 解决方案:通过FDL的数据治理功能,对客户信息数据进行清洗、校验和同步,确保数据的准确性和完整性。
- 成效:实现了客户信息数据的高效同步和管理,增强了精准营销的能力,提高了客户关系管理的质量。
这些案例展示了金融行业数据同步的各种可能性和效果,并强调了使用专业数据集成平台的重要性。在实施数据同步方案时,金融机构应根据自身的业务需求和数据特征,选择合适的技术和工具,以实现最佳的同步效果。